BJP exposed Tripura MP Jiten Choudhury's dirty political game via Social Media : calls him 'Anti-Nationalist' for creating racial unrest !
TIWN March 24, 2017

AGARTALA, March 24 (TIWN): CPI-M MP Jiten Choudhury would never visit Chittamara village, unless the election was nearby and there was no contest with newly emerged party BJP, claims BJP Vice President Subal Bhowmik following Jiten Choudhury's badmouthing against BJP, when BJP members donated Rs. 50,000 per deceased families and Rs. 15,000 per wounded people's families. 'What CPI-M has done apart from creating unrest and hatred among the tribals for vote banks? Not only this, using his MP Power Choudhury is playing politics at New Delhi', said Bhowmik. Jiten Choudhury had shared BJP's meeting with Chittamara deceased families and their donation of Rs. 50000 to the families and reacting over the event BJP counter attacked the Ganamukti Parishad leader cum MP Jiten Choudhury who instead of asking the state govt to help the families are busy in bad mouthing against Nation's BSF Jawans. "Is Jiten Choudhury an investigating officer ? Jiten Choudhury almost has submitted a chargesheet in his Facebook account regarding which time, which place, where blood spots were found etc as he knows everything. Who gave him right to give the final judgment? Whatever the incident was it will be investigated but most important is to help the poor families which CPI-M has ended with Rs. 10,000/-. If they want to give they shoulod give 5 lakhs rupees and also a job per family", Bhowmik added.

However, BJP demanding further investigation into the case donated Rs. 50,000/- at Party Office. Reportedly, out of 3 families, 1 family was a CPI-M supporter, but State Govt has donated nothing to them. However, Biplab Deb mentioned that investigation is going on and there will be no flaw into the investigation.

It's worthy to mention here that Jiten Choudhury on March 20, at 11.50 PM had uploaded a picture when BJP leaders were visiting the deceased families and wrote " DOUBLE STANDARD : BJP's Social Media Group and a section of media close to them are active in claiming that the three victims of Chitabari are cattle lifters and offenders upon the BSF. Today BJP leaders are shedding crocodile's tear there and valuing Rs.50,000 against each life? IS NOT IT AN INSULT TO THIS BEREAVED POOR TRIBAL FAMILIES AND DOUBLE STANDARD OF BJP? SHAME ON BJP".

BJP reacting over the uploading of the MP, Subal Bhowmik called him Anti-Nationalist and also asked what CPI-M has given to them? 'Jiten is playing politics rather than real sympathy for the families.
